Look for dentists who keep current licenses on file and are willing to provide written treatment plans and cost estimates upfront. Transparency about fees, materials, and expected outcomes is a strong indicator of a professional practice. Be cautious of practices that pressure you into immediate treatment, demand cash-only payment with no receipt, or operate solely online without a physical office. Ask whether the dentist stays current through continuing education and whether they're willing to discuss treatment alternatives with you.
